Corteva Agriscience is seeking a Global Income Tax Accounting Leader to join our Finance Department. This position is based in Wilmington, DE and offers a hybrid work arrangement (in office three days per week).
The Global Income Tax Accounting Leader is responsible for leading company’s global income tax accounting and reporting process under U.S. GAAP (ASC 740). This role has primary responsibility for managing the quarterly and annual income tax provision, including the effective tax rate, deferred taxes, uncertain tax positions, and related disclosures.
The position directly manages a small global tax accounting team and provides leadership across a broader group of stakeholders involved in the provision process, including U.S. and foreign tax, controllership, and finance teams. While the role operates with technical oversight and partnership from the Director, the Global Income Tax Accounting Leader is accountable for day-to-day execution, coordination, and delivery of global tax accounting results.
The position serves as the primary technical authority for income tax accounting, provides strategic leadership across global tax reporting activities, and partners closely with U.S. compliance, planning, treasury, FP&A, controllership, and auditors. This leader also plays a key role in evaluating the tax accounting impact of business initiatives, legislative and regulatory changes, and complex transactions.
